Output 570513074e8829dbd3c47edd7a75e1fa1175a9021a7dc4dbe03026f10fb256f7:3

value
315300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fec673ff9a12574fbaa1e77366df6c711ccde6bf OP_EQUAL
address
3Qv9J2sf6URfBgSvhNV6JM85aAWMdjxx7H
transaction
570513074e8829dbd3c47edd7a75e1fa1175a9021a7dc4dbe03026f10fb256f7
spent
true